The first three episodes of All’s Fair, Ryan Murphy’s buzzy new legal drama, have officially hit Hulu and Disney+. Wondering when the rest are coming? Here’s everything to know about the release schedule, episode count and how to watch the high anticipated freshman series, which debuted on Nov. 4.

All’s Fair follows a team of female divorce attorneys who leave a male-dominated firm to start their own practice. “Fierce, brilliant, and emotionally complicated, they navigate high-stakes breakups, scandalous secrets, and shifting allegiances — both in the courtroom and within their own ranks,” the synopsis reads. “In a world where money talks and love is a battleground, these women don’t just play the game — they change it.”

The series stars Kim Kardashian as Allura Grant, Naomi Watts as Liberty Ronson, Niecy Nash-Betts as Emerald Greene, Teyana Taylor as Milan, Sarah Paulson as Carrington Lane, and Glenn Close as Dina Standish.

ForbesThe Best New TV Shows Streaming In November 2025 On Netflix, Hulu And More

In an interview with Deadline, Murphy said that he and Kardashian matriarch Kris Jenner had an idea from Kim to play a divorce attorney, and the executives at Hulu said yes immediately. He also called Jenner “a phenomenal producing partner.”

Meanwhile, Kardashian told the outlet that the series — whose official trailer garnered an impressive 44 million views — proved to her that “there’s really no limitations in life.”

“I never felt like I had to be stuck in this box that I couldn’t do what I wanted to do, or at least try,” she continued. “There’s no age limit. There’s no barriers. Anything you want to do, try. What’s the worst that can happen, just go for it. Just start. Just do it.”

If you’ve finished the first three episodes of All’s Fair and are curious when new episodes arrive, you’re in luck. Here’s a breakdown of everything you need to know about watching Season 1.

When Do New Episodes Of All’s Fair Season 1 Come Out?

Disney

New episodes of All’s Fair are released every Tuesday at 3 a.m. ET/midnight PT on Hulu and Disney+.

How Many Episodes Are In All’s Fair Season 1?

There will be a total of 10 episodes in the debut season of All’s Fair.

What Is The All’s Fair Season 1 Release Schedule?

The first three episodes of All’s Fair premiered on Hulu and Disney+ on Tuesday, Nov. 4. The remaining seven episodes will roll out weekly, with the Season 1 finale set for Tuesday, Dec. 23, 2025. Check out the full release schedule and available episode titles below.

  • Episode 1, “Pilot”: Tuesday, Nov. 4 (premiere)
  • Episode 2, “When We Were Young”: Tuesday, Nov. 4
  • Episode 3, “I Want Revenge”: Tuesday, Nov. 4
  • Episode 4, “Everybody Dance Now”: Tuesday, Nov. 11
  • Episode 5, “This Is Me Trying”: Tuesday, Nov. 18
  • Episode 6, “TBA”: Tuesday, Nov. 25
  • Episode 7, “TBA”: Tuesday, Dec. 2
  • Episode 8, “TBA”: Tuesday, Dec. 9
  • Episode 9, “TBA”: Tuesday, Dec. 16
  • Episode 10, “TBA”: Tuesday, Dec. 23 (finale)

How To Watch All’s Fair Season 1

All’s Fair is exclusively available to stream on Hulu and Disney+. The Hulu and Disney+ bundle starts at $12.99, while the Disney+ and Hulu Bundle Premium costs $19.99. Check out all of Hulu’s plans and pricing details here.

Can You Watch All’s Fair Season 1 For Free?

Hulu offers free trials for new and eligible returning subscribers. However, the trial duration depends on the plan you choose. Visit Hulu’s website to explore all available options and watch a portion of All’s Fair Season 1 for free.
